The Las Vegas poker rooms are currently open and operating at a limited capacity. Players must wear masks at all times and are only allowed to sit at every other table.
The number of players per table is also limited.
Despite the current restrictions, the Las Vegas poker rooms are still a great place to play. The dealers and staff are professional and friendly, and the games are exciting.
PRO TIP:Las Vegas poker rooms are currently open with occupancy limited to 50% capacity and Covid-19 safety protocols in place. Social distancing is enforced and masks are required at all times while playing.

Are Any Las Vegas Poker Rooms Open?
Yes, some Las Vegas poker rooms are currently open. However, many of the smaller rooms have closed due to the COVID-19 pandemic. The Wynn, Bellagio, and Venetian are among the casinos that have kept their poker rooms open.

Is Magic City Poker Room Open?
Yes, the Magic City Poker Room is open. It is located on the second floor of the Magic City Casino in Miami, Florida. The room has 35 tables and offers a variety of cash games and tournaments.
